More Counter & & Cabinet Space A range cooker installed on a kitchen island offers more counter and cabinet area compared to a cooktop installed on a wall. This is especially valuable for property owners who desire more storage choices along the border of their room or have an open-concept layout that requires a visual divider in between the kitchen, dining area, and living space. When picking a range cooker island, think about the size of your existing cooking home appliances along with the height of your counters. Then, purchase slide-in ranges that are a perfect fit. For instance, the Whirlpool brand has multiple models that incorporate magnificently with kitchen islands and use settings like air cooking technology1 that can assist you bake, roast, and broil more efficiently. Another factor to consider is just how much space you need to maneuver around your cooking location. For optimum performance, experts recommend keeping a minimum range of 42 to 48 inches in between your island and other cabinets to ensure you have sufficient space to move, work, and mingle without feeling confined. When selecting a new counter top for your range cooker island, select durable products that can stand up to heavy usage. Quartz and granite countertops are both lasting and extremely flexible, and they can hold up against heat from your cooktop. These types of surfaces are also simple to clean, which is necessary for a kitchen that regularly hosts guests or relative.
